Arya Stark is born as the third child of Eddard and Catelyn Stark—she never wanted to be a lady or waste time with formality.

She thought that it was a boring task better left to her siblings.

However, young Arya found herself on a new adventure after her father was murdered.

She would travel across Westeros and to Essos where she trained to be a Faceless Man.

This transformed her into a master swordswoman and deadly assassin.

It was a transformation that would alter the course of her life—and all of Westeros—forever.

This guide contains the best perks for Arya Stark in MultiVersus and the unlockable perks you can obtain per level.

Best perks for Arya Stark in MultiVersus

Best Arya Stark Perks

Best perks for Arya Stark in MultiVersus

  • Signature perk: Betrayal – Hitting an ally with Arya’s dagger has a longer cooldown, but the ally is given an enraged buff. If Arya dashes to a dagger on an ally, she enrages herself.
  • Perk 1: Snowball Effect – Your team deals 7% increased damage against the fighter with the highest damage.
  • Perk 2: Last Stand – Your team deals 10% increased damage after reaching 100 damage.
  • Perk 3: Wildcat Brawler – Your team deals 5% increased damage with melee attacks on the ground.
